The evaluation of three methods for the diagnosis of initial posterior approximal caries

Yun LI ; Yujing LI ; Lihua GE

Journal of Practical Stomatology.1996;0(02):-.

Objective: To evaluate the diagnostic efficacy of the bitewing radiograph(BWR),clinic examination(CE) and laser fluorescence examination (LF) for detection of initial posterior approximal caries . Methods:A total of 162 approximal surfaces from 81 extracted posterior teeth were examined by BWR, CE and LF. The histological diagnosis of sectioned teeth was used as the validating criterion (gold standard) to assess the sensitivity, specificity, accuracy and reproducibility. Results: The sensitivity and accuracy of BWR was higher than those of CE or LF at the level of enamel caries. Conclusions: BWR is an accurate diagnostic method for initial posterior approximal caries in present clinic practice. The inferior efficacy of LF is mainly due to its poor reproducibility of approximal surfaces.

Random amplified polymorphic DNA analysis of candida isolates from oral carriage

Jufen ZHOU ; Yanying XU ; Ruoyu LI

Journal of Practical Stomatology.1996;0(02):-.

Objective: To compare the biotype and genetic similarity between groups of commensal and pathogenic strains of candida species. Methods:Random amplified polymorphic DNA (RAPD) was used to analyse the type of Candida albicans. Results: 12 pathogenic isolates of Candida albicans, 3 commensal isolates of Candida abicans and 3 isolates of pathogenic non-albicans were obtained. The similarity coefficient of albicans with non-albicans was 51.7% by RAPD. Intra-candida similarity coefficient was more than 70%. Both the commensal and pathogenic isolates showed the genetically similar to C. albicans. Intro-isolate DNA polymorphism was observed by RAPD. Conclusion: Both the commensal and pathogenic groups contain a major cluster of genetically similar C. albicans isolates.

Disinfection effect of root canal with non-filling medication in root canal therapy

Peng GUO ; Buling WU ; Yinghua BI

Journal of Practical Stomatology.1996;0(02):-.

Objective: To observe the clinical disinfection effect of root canal with non-filling medication. Methods: 36 patients who required root canal therapy(RCT) for apical periodontitis (acute or chronic) or pulp necrosis were involved in the study.RCT was completed after two visits in both groups. Non-filling medication was used as disinfection in 18 teeth of 18 patients (experimental group) while FC in another 18 teeth of 18 patients (control group) randomly at first visit.One week later,root canal was regularly filled to complete RCT.From each case, bacteria specimens were collected and identified before sealing and filling. Results: Bacteria were detected in every specimen in both groups before sealing,which were mixture of aerobes and anaerobes.One week later,only one strain was detected in one specimen of each group. Conclusion: Non-filling medication can be used as an effective disinfection to sterilize root canal.

A study on the regularity of center of rotation in the orthodontic treatment of embedded and inverted impact upper central incisor

Qinbo WANG ; Ling WANG ; Younan LIU

Journal of Practical Stomatology.1996;0(02):-.

Objective: To study the influence of different inhibition conditions for center of rotation (CR) and regularity variations of CR before and after orthodontic treatment of embedded and inverted impact upper central incisor. Methods:Based on clinical findings a computer model of rolling movement was established,then computer finite element Super DrawnⅡwas applied to establish an analytic analogue computing model for calculation. Results:The deeper the crown embedded by hard tissue,the more the edgewise displacement of CR;while the crown was normally exposed,the moving locus tended toward front and upward. Conclusions: Perpendicular orthodontic force to the long axis of tooth forced point that close to the incisal margin and the partly embedded crown by the alveolar bone,especially the bone of lingual aspect are the main factors for the upward moving and erectness of the root apex. Possible subsidence of CR may be avoided by suitable early stage orthodontic treatment.
